Meaning & Origin
Gitiksha is derived from the Sanskrit words gitam (knowledge) and kshaya (to learn or study). This name signifies the pursuit of knowledge and wisdom. It is also associated with the Hindu goddess Saraswati, the goddess of learning and knowledge.

Cultural & Spiritual notes
The name Gitiksha holds cultural significance as it embodies the spirit of seeking knowledge and education, which has been a core value in Hinduism and Indian culture for centuries. It inspires a continuous dedication to learning and intellectual growth, honoring the rich traditions of wisdom and knowledge-seeking within the culture.
Spiritually, the name Gitiksha calls to the inner scholar and intellectual within each individual. It represents the divine spark of knowledge and understanding that exists within us all. The name serves as a reminder of our own potential for learning and growth, highlighting the spiritual benefits that come from seeking knowledge and wisdom. In addition, the association with the Hindu goddess Saraswati adds a deeper spiritual layer, expressing the idea that the pursuit of knowledge is a form of devotion and a means of connecting with the divine.
